Travel by train from London King's Cross to Hartlepool

With trains running hourly throughout the day, you can travel by train from London King's Cross to Hartlepool with ease. The journey spans 223 miles, giving you adequate time to sit back, relax and watch the changing scenery whizz by, without having to think twice about a stressful drive.

What train company runs the London King's Cross to Hartlepool route?

Trains from London King's Cross to Hartlepool are operated by Grand Central and LNER, with an average of 17 trains running per day. The route is direct, so you don’t need to worry about changing trains.

What line is the London King's Cross to Hartlepool service on?

The London King's Cross to Hartlepool train journey is part of Grand Central’s longer route, which takes passengers from London to Sunderland.

How long does the train from London King's Cross to Hartlepool take?

The train from London King's Cross to Hartlepool takes an average of 2 hours and 56 minutes. Services start at around 6 am, running regularly until 19:27. There are trains between London King's Cross and Hartlepool departing after this time, but the route isn’t direct and requires you to change once or twice.

Where do trains from London King's Cross to Hartlepool stop?

When you journey from London King's Cross to Hartlepool on a Grand Central or LNER train, you’ll stop at a handful of places along the way. This includes York, Thirsk, Northallerton and Eaglescliffe, before arriving in Hartlepool. The train then continues to Sunderland.

Hartlepool facilities and things to do in the local area

Hartlepool Station is compact, but don’t be fooled by its relatively small size. With its impressive range of facilities, it’s a station that makes onward travel and exploring the local area simple from the moment you step off the train. Facilities include ticket machines, accessible toilets, customer help points, parking, drop off and pick up points, bike storage and step-free access to all platforms for passengers with reduced mobility. The station is centrally located, so you’re only a short walk from the heart of the town.

Once you’re in Hartlepool, there’s plenty to see and do. You’ll find yourself just a few minutes from the National Museum of the Royal Navy Hartlepool, where you can explore historic ships and learn about the area’s maritime past. The marina is also close by, which boasts an abundance of restaurants, cafes and bars for you to check out. From quick bites to eat, to sit-down meals, Hartlepool is fantastic for foodies. If you’re looking to relax and stretch your legs after your train journey, the seafront, beaches, and Ward Jackson Park are popular spots.
